Urge to Assign Registration Task to Healthcare Facilities- Speakers at Journalists’ Workshop

Urge to Assign Registration Task to Healthcare Facilities- Speakers at Journalists’ Workshop

Breaking News, NGO News
Birth and death registration is essential to guarantee citizen rights such as education, healthcare, inheritance, and voting rights. Registration data is also crucial for national planning, good governance, and budget preparation. Currently, the birth and death registration rates in Bangladesh stand at 50% and 47%, respectively which is significantly lower than the global and regional averages. However, the government is committed to scaling up this rate to 100% by 2030. According to experts, amending the 'Birth and Death Registration Act, 2004' to legally mandate hospital authorities with registration responsibilities would fast-track the achievement of this target. BRAC Enterprises inaugurates Greenpak factory

BRAC Enterprises inaugurates Greenpak factory

Breaking News, Business
BRAC Enterprises has inaugurated its Greenpak factory in the Tongi Industrial Area of Gazipur, marking a significant step towards advancing environmentally friendly and sustainable packaging solutions in Bangladesh. The facility has the capacity to produce 300–350 metric tonnes of eco-friendly, biodegradable packaging annually. Unlike conventional plastic, the biodegradable products manufactured at the factory naturally decompose within six months. The Greenpak factory was formally inaugurated on Tuesday, 7 July 2026, by Tamara Hasan Abed, Managing Director of BRAC Enterprises. UAP and DPDT Sign MoU to Boost Research, Innovation and IP Protection

UAP and DPDT Sign MoU to Boost Research, Innovation and IP Protection

Breaking News, Education
University of Asia Pacific (UAP) and the Department of Patents, Industrial Designs and Trademarks (DPDT), Ministry of Industries, sign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) on Tuesday, 7 July 2026, at the Vice Chancellor's Conference Room of UAP to strengthen intellectual property (IP) protection, promote innovation, and support patent registration for researchers. The signing was followed by a program and training session, where the establishment of a Technology and Innovation Support Centre (TISC) at UAP was also discussed to enhance innovation support and facilitate access to patent information and technology resources.
